Objectives
This module will help you to engage in consistent, high quality, and well-reasoned decision-making for your role in hearing member proceedings. More specifically you will learn how to:
- Follow a structured approach to support consistent, high quality and well-reasoned decision-making
- Identify and assess relevant information before making decisions
- Reach a decision and then determine action to take (e.g. conditions) if any, based on the information and level of risk
- Construct a well-reasoned and clearly articulated decision document
